Event Description
A physician reported the patient experienced postoperative anterior chamber hemorrhage post trabeculectomy procedure.During postoperative examination the physician noticed fibrous foreign body attached to the nasal side of the anterior chamber of the left eye.Additional procedure was performed to remove the foreign material from the eye.
 
Manufacturer Narrative
The customer did not retain the product lot information for this custom pak, therefore the device history records traceable to the reported procedure pack could not be reviewed.The customer reported that a piece of foreign was present in their pak.One plastic case with reported foreign material was returned.Several foreign materials were observed in the returned case, however, the customer identified that no.1 of attached picture is the foreign material of the reported complaint.Approximately 1 mm of brownish fiber-like foreign material was observed.Analysis from the particle lab determined that the material inside of the cup was wypall fibers (paper).While the sample confirmed the presence of wypall fibers, the root cause of the customer's complaint could not be conclusively determine as it is unknown when or where the material was first introduced to the pak.An action plan is in place to improve debris containment in the custom pak manufacturing environment to prevent recurrence.Complaints are continuously monitored to identify product and/or process areas where debris and hair is occurring.In addition, routine training and awareness is conducted with all manufacturing associates to reinforce the importance of wearing proper personal protective equipment (ppe) and maintaining clean work areas.Quality assurance has reviewed this complaint and will continue to monitor data for evidence of adverse trending.The manufacturer internal reference number is: (b)(4).
